aboutsummaryrefslogtreecommitdiffstats
path: root/resources/tools/presentation/generator_tables.py
diff options
context:
space:
mode:
authorTibor Frank <tifrank@cisco.com>2020-03-23 14:05:58 +0100
committerTibor Frank <tifrank@cisco.com>2020-03-23 14:05:58 +0100
commitd3467a74642fc11c81533414d552a757094a8a3c (patch)
treeed909efefd390d8cadbb7f0de0e06e871f6baf8f /resources/tools/presentation/generator_tables.py
parent967cdb11f34dce8fe427e7db7130afcd8464d7b3 (diff)
Report: Add data
Change-Id: I72cf83bfae9f07691157d2baee436e4021cd87dc Signed-off-by: Tibor Frank <tifrank@cisco.com>
Diffstat (limited to 'resources/tools/presentation/generator_tables.py')
-rw-r--r--resources/tools/presentation/generator_tables.py40
1 files changed, 32 insertions, 8 deletions
diff --git a/resources/tools/presentation/generator_tables.py b/resources/tools/presentation/generator_tables.py
index bdd6e22cf7..5cd3553074 100644
--- a/resources/tools/presentation/generator_tables.py
+++ b/resources/tools/presentation/generator_tables.py
@@ -822,8 +822,14 @@ def table_perf_comparison(table, input_data):
delta, d_stdev = relative_change_stdev(
data_r_mean, data_c_mean, data_r_stdev, data_c_stdev
)
- item.append(round(delta))
- item.append(round(d_stdev))
+ try:
+ item.append(round(delta))
+ except ValueError:
+ item.append(delta)
+ try:
+ item.append(round(d_stdev))
+ except ValueError:
+ item.append(d_stdev)
if (len(item) == len(header)) and (item[-4] != u"Not tested"):
tbl_lst.append(item)
@@ -1115,8 +1121,14 @@ def table_perf_comparison_nic(table, input_data):
delta, d_stdev = relative_change_stdev(
data_r_mean, data_c_mean, data_r_stdev, data_c_stdev
)
- item.append(round(delta))
- item.append(round(d_stdev))
+ try:
+ item.append(round(delta))
+ except ValueError:
+ item.append(delta)
+ try:
+ item.append(round(d_stdev))
+ except ValueError:
+ item.append(d_stdev)
if (len(item) == len(header)) and (item[-4] != u"Not tested"):
tbl_lst.append(item)
@@ -1253,8 +1265,14 @@ def table_nics_comparison(table, input_data):
delta, d_stdev = relative_change_stdev(
data_r_mean, data_c_mean, data_r_stdev, data_c_stdev
)
- item.append(round(delta))
- item.append(round(d_stdev))
+ try:
+ item.append(round(delta))
+ except ValueError:
+ item.append(delta)
+ try:
+ item.append(round(d_stdev))
+ except ValueError:
+ item.append(d_stdev)
tbl_lst.append(item)
# Sort the table according to the relative change
@@ -1387,8 +1405,14 @@ def table_soak_vs_ndr(table, input_data):
if data_r_mean and data_c_mean:
delta, d_stdev = relative_change_stdev(
data_r_mean, data_c_mean, data_r_stdev, data_c_stdev)
- item.append(round(delta))
- item.append(round(d_stdev))
+ try:
+ item.append(round(delta))
+ except ValueError:
+ item.append(delta)
+ try:
+ item.append(round(d_stdev))
+ except ValueError:
+ item.append(d_stdev)
tbl_lst.append(item)
# Sort the table according to the relative change